When We Eventually Made It To Our Hotel After The

When we eventually made it to our hotel after the taxi driver got lost for over an hour, we had the difficulty of booking in due to a non-English speaking man and a young boy. We had requested at least one room on the ground floor as we had a wheelchair bound member, we were given the top floor. My father was then given a room but not given a key. He had to ask at the desk every time he needed his room which was not good with the language problem.

The hotel is close to a few bar restaurants which all offer the same food, but the one we favored is called Cheers and is just 2 minutes from the hotel. Food is good, drinks are cheap.

The beach is advertised as a few hundred metres away, which is true. However for us it was a struggle as it is a few hundred metres down a very steep climb. Very hard work with the wheelchair.

Breakfast at the hotel consisted of cheese, some form of meat, olives and melon. Chunky bread and jam were generously on offer too. This did not change at all for any of the days we were there. The pool is unusually cold, and the sun seemed to be hidden by the hotel in the afternoon. A bar is on hand near the pool, selling Efes or cocktails.

This review seems a little negative, which is a shame as I personally enjoyed most of the holiday. Nights were good, big screen television showing Euro matches, karaoke nights, some good music, the weather was beautiful and the nearby harbor and ruins were great to visit. One warning though - if you are offered anything make sure you agree a price beforehand. I had a shave and was rather taken aback when he wanted 50 lire (20 pounds) after he had finished - he got 15.

If You Are Looking For Cheap, Clean, But No Frills

If you are looking for cheap, clean, but no frills accommodation, the Daisy Hotel in Side is a great base. It's within walking distance of the Harbour area. where the Remains of Apollo's Temple Lie adjacent to the beach. A beautiful spot for sunset. There's so much to see in Side, and the eating places and atmosphere are great.
